Today, the sorting of collected clothes is largely done manually, which is both costly and involves heavy, monotonous tasks. At the same time, the amount of textiles collected is increasing sharply in connection with new laws from the EU, and society is facing major challenges in managing this in a sustainable way.
In the project, we will develop a robotic system that can recognize and handle mixed materials, e.g, clothes, shoes, bags and toys, and decide whether they should be sorted out immediately (for example, inappropriate items) or proceed for valuation and various reuses in the textile value chain. This first phase of the sorting chain is very demanding as it involves large volumes with varying content, but it is crucial to enable efficient reuse later in the process.
